By Tigertail Productions and Florida Dance Association From Jun 25th through Jun 29th, 2007One of the highlights of the Florida Dance Festival is the DanceAble Event, a collaborative project co-presented by Tigertail Productions and Florida Dance Association. This program is part of a burgeoning global disability arts movement. Aimed at gathering dance artists and professionals, DanceAble’s workshops, seminars and other activities confront traditional ideologies and challenge the notion of who can create and perform this ever-evolving art form. New Zealand’s Touch Compass is this year’s featured company for DanceAble. This vibrant, theatrical, integrated dance company from Auckland, New Zealand, mixes film, aerial work and dance/theater in their concerts. The company is in residence from June 25th through 29th, offering aerial workshops, a film screening and a full evening performance. For the second year in a row, the half-day forum, Beyond Accessibility, Impacting the Lives of Artists with Disabilities, in partnership with VSA arts of Florida, takes place at the Miami Dade College, ETCOTA Auditorium. The forum is a unique opportunity to share challenges and successes with South Florida, national and international leaders in the field of mixed ability arts. Special forum guests include Judy Smith, Artistic Director of AXIS Dance Company and John Killacky, Program Officer for Arts and Culture at the San Francisco Foundation.
